A Brief History of Alcatraz

Before we delve into the pics of Alcatraz prisoners, let's set the stage with a quick history lesson. Alcatraz, known as "The Rock," was a maximum-security federal prison on an island in San Francisco Bay, California. It opened in 1934 and operated until 1963, housing some of America's most notorious criminals. Its remote location and frigid waters made escape nearly impossible, earning it the reputation of being inescapable.

Life After Alcatraz

Alcatraz Island, San Francisco, California, 1963. Photo by Warren K. Leffler, U.S. News & World Report Magazine

In 1963, the U.S. Bureau of Prisons deemed Alcatraz too expensive to operate and closed it down. The island was then transferred to the National Park Service, and today, it's a popular tourist destination.
